POSITION SUMMARY
The patient flow scheduler coordinates inpatient and outpatient bed assignments according to algorithms, unit criteria, bed requests and hospital protocol. The patient flow scheduler collaborates with nursing unit team leaders to ensure accurate and timely placement of patients using the electronic bed tracking system. The patient flow scheduler is responsible for highly detailed work in the registration system. The patient flow scheduler provides excellent customer service to both internal and external customers.

This position supports organizational goals by providing quality customer service, participating in performance improvement efforts and demonstrating a commitment to teamwork and cooperation.
